Muscular Activity Patterns In 1-Legged Vs. 2-Legged Pedaling, Sangsoo Park, Graham E. Caldwell
Muscular Activity Patterns In 1-Legged Vs. 2-Legged Pedaling, Sangsoo Park, Graham E. Caldwell
Kinesiology Department Faculty Publication Series
Background: One-legged pedaling is of interest to elite cyclists and clinicians. However, muscular usage in 1-legged vs. 2-legged pedaling is not fully understood. Thus, the study was aimed to examine changes in leg muscle activation patterns between 2-legged and 1-legged pedaling. Methods: Fifteen healthy young recreational cyclists performed both 1-legged and 2-legged pedaling trials at about 30 Watt per leg. Surface electromyography electrodes were placed on 10 major muscles of the left leg. Linear envelope electromyography data were integrated to quantify muscle activities for each crank cycle quadrant to evaluate muscle activation changes.
